Jack’s story first captivated national attention in 2013. At the tender age of seven, he was diagnosed with a rare form of brain cancer. Despite the immense challenges he faced, Jack’s spirit remained unbroken. His love for the Cornhuskers was a constant source of joy and strength. This passion led to a truly unforgettable moment that transcended the boundaries of sports and became a symbol of hope and perseverance.

 

During the 2013 Nebraska spring game, then-Head Coach Bo Pelini orchestrated a moment that would forever be etched in college football history. With just minutes left in the game, Jack was brought onto the field in his full uniform, complete with a helmet. He took a handoff and, with the help of the players, ran for a 69-yard touchdown. Memorial Stadium erupted in a thunderous roar, a mix of cheers and tears. The sight of Jack, beaming with pure joy as he crossed the goal line, became an iconic image, a powerful reminder of the human spirit’s ability to find light even in the darkest of times.

 

This extraordinary moment wasn’t just a fleeting spectacle; it forged a deep and lasting bond between Jack and the Nebraska football program. He became a regular presence at practices, games, and team events. Players and coaches embraced him as one of their own, finding inspiration in his unwavering courage and infectious positivity. Jack wasn’t just a fan; he was a member of the Cornhuskers family.

 

Beyond the football field, Jack’s story resonated with people far and wide. His courage in the face of his illness inspired countless individuals facing their own battles. He became an advocate for pediatric cancer research, raising awareness and funds for organizations dedicated to finding cures. The “Jack Hoffman Foundation” was established to support pediatric brain cancer research and provide support to families affected by the disease.
